🍫 Elevate your chocolate game with Kerala’s boldest beans!
Premium single-origin Forastero cocoa beans sourced directly from Kerala’s Idukki district, naturally fermented and sun-dried using traditional methods. These Grade 1 beans feature a uniform size with 90-100 beans per 100 grams, boasting higher butter content and rich aroma, ideal for artisanal bean-to-bar chocolate making. Backed by 40+ years of farming expertise and trusted by top Indian chocolatiers.

The roasted cocoa nibs tasted tangy!
I skipped the conching and tempering process, the chocolates turned out great but this bag of cacao beans produced tangy and fruity kind of chocolate. But overall I liked the taste. Will experiment more. This batch was roasted at 140°C for 26 min, next I will trying out the 170°C for 20 min one. Edit (18/03/22): so 170°C for 20 min turned out to be the best roasting temperature. Conch the chocolate liquor for 2 hrs in wet grinder, you will have some smooth tasting chocolate!!!
